Diagnosing Leaf Blower Begin-Up Issues

Understanding why your leaf blower refuses to start out is essential for efficient troubleshooting. Gasoline points, spark plug malfunctions, and air filter obstructions are widespread culprits. Referencing the components diagram will provide help to isolate the issue.

  • Low Gasoline: Verify the gas degree and make sure the gas line is not obstructed. A gas pump or a defective gas line could cause issues too. Examine the gas filter for blockages and exchange if wanted.
  • Spark Plug Malfunction: A defective spark plug can forestall the engine from igniting. The components diagram reveals the spark plug’s location. Verify for injury, gaps, or extreme carbon buildup. Changing a worn-out spark plug is a fast repair. The diagram will provide help to find the spark plug for straightforward substitute.

  • Clogged Air Filter: A clogged air filter restricts airflow, hindering the engine’s means to operate correctly. The components diagram shows the air filter’s place. Cleansing or changing the air filter is crucial for optimum efficiency. You’ll want to comply with the producer’s suggestions for cleansing or changing the filter.

Diagnosing Leaf Blower Operation Issues

Past start-up points, different issues can come up throughout operation. The components diagram is a worthwhile device for figuring out the supply of those points.

  • Decreased Blower Energy: A doable trigger is a blocked impeller or a broken blade. The diagram reveals the impeller’s location and tips on how to examine it for injury or blockages. Inspecting the impeller is essential for sustaining blower energy.
  • Uncommon Noise: Uncommon noises, similar to grinding or screeching, usually sign an issue with bearings, belts, or different transferring components. The components diagram helps find these parts. Figuring out the supply of the noise is essential to efficient restore. A broken or worn-out belt might require substitute.
  • Overheating: Overheating is a big drawback, usually brought on by insufficient cooling or a malfunctioning fan. The diagram reveals the placement of the fan and cooling system parts. Examine the fan blades for blockages and guarantee satisfactory airflow. Overheating can result in critical injury. Following the producer’s directions for upkeep and operation can assist keep away from overheating.

Troubleshooting Desk

This desk summarizes widespread points, potential causes, and troubleshooting steps, offering a fast reference information.

Concern Potential Trigger Troubleshooting Steps
Blower will not begin Low gas, spark plug points, clogged air filter, or an issue with the gas system Verify gas degree, examine spark plug for injury, clear or exchange air filter. Verify gas strains and the gas pump if wanted.
Decreased Blower Energy Clogged impeller, broken blades, or obstructed air consumption Examine impeller for blockages, verify for injury to blades. Examine the air consumption for blockages.
Uncommon Noise Worn-out bearings, unfastened belts, or broken housing Examine bearings for put on, tighten unfastened belts, and verify for any injury to the housing.
Overheating Clogged cooling system, malfunctioning fan, or insufficient airflow Clear the cooling system, examine the fan for blockages, and guarantee satisfactory airflow across the blower.
